Misconceptions Regarding LASIK Pain
Unlike popular belief, LASIK surgery isn't as painful as lots of people believe. The treatment itself is fairly fast and painless. You may really feel some pressure or pain throughout the surgical treatment, but it's generally marginal. The doctor will certainly utilize numbing eye goes down to make certain that you do not feel any pain throughout the process.
While it's typical to experience some dry skin, itchiness, or mild pain in the hours complying with the surgery, this can normally be handled with non-prescription discomfort medication and eye decreases. It is very important to follow your physician's post-operative treatment guidelines to minimize any type of pain and advertise correct recovery.
Remember that everyone's pain resistance is different, so what a single person might refer to as uneasy may be totally bearable for one more. Feel confident that LASIK discomfort is generally not a major problem and shouldn't prevent you from considering this life-changing treatment.
Dangers Associated With LASIK
Lots of individuals undertaking LASIK surgical procedure are primarily concerned regarding possible threats related to the procedure. While LASIK is a safe and efficient treatment for vision Correction, like any surgical procedure, it does include some dangers.
The most usual threats related to LASIK consist of dry eyes, glow, halos, and trouble driving at night in the prompt postoperative period. These signs and symptoms are normally short-lived and boost as the eyes heal.

Qualification Misconceptions
Some individuals erroneously believe that only individuals with severe vision issues are eligible for LASIK surgical procedure. However, this is a common misunderstanding. While LASIK is typically connected with treating high degrees of n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ism, people with milder vision issues can also be qualified candidates. LASIK qualification is established via a comprehensive eye evaluation by a certified eye doctor. Elements such as corneal thickness, eye wellness, and overall medical history play a crucial role in examining a patient's suitability for the surgery.
